b2c信息网

您现在的位置是:首页 > 热点问题 > 正文

热点问题

java图书商城源码(java图书系统源代码)

hacker2022-06-14 00:44:20热点问题40
本文目录一览:1、网络图书商城系统用java编写的源代码以及注释

本文目录一览:

网络图书商城系统用java编写的源代码以及注释

关于图书Java商城系统可以了解下mcmore电商系统,源代码什么的咨询客服。

求java编程源代码,关于图书借阅系统的,

/

用户登陆数据库代码:

import java.sql.*;

class Database {

Connection con;

ResultSet rs;

Statement stmt;

public Database() {

try {

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");

//

加载

JDBC-ODBC

桥驱动程序

String url = "jdbcdbc:HDB";

con = DriverManager.getConnection(url);

//

连接数据库

HDB //stmt

提供一个创建

SQL

查询、执行查询、得到返回结果

的空间

stmt =

// con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,

// ResultSet.CONCUR_READ_ONLY);

} catch (Exception ex) {

System.out.println(ex);

}

}

/*

根据用户名,获取密码

*/

public String getPswd(String name) {

try {

// rs

为执行

SQL

语句所查询的结果赋给结果集对象

rs

rs = stmt.executeQuery("SELECT pswd FROM User WHERE Name = '"

+ name + "'");

rs.last();

//

rs

的指针移到最后一行

if (rs.getRow() == 0) {

return null;

} else {

String pswdDB = rs.getString("Pswd");

//

获取

rs

结果集中的

pswd

列的数据

return pswdDB;

}

} catch (Exception e) {

System.out.println(e);

return null;

}

}

/*

增加一行用户名、密码数据

*/

public boolean insertData(String name, String pswd) {

try {

String s = getPswd(name);

if (s == null) {

int rtn = stmt.executeUpdate("INSERT INTO User VALUES('" + name

+ "','" + pswd + "')");

if (rtn != 0)

return true;

} else {

return false;

}

return false;

} catch (Exception et) {

System.out.println(et);

return false;

}

}

}

//

进库数据库代码:

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.ResultSet;

import java.sql.Statement;

class BookDatabase {

Connection con;

ResultSet rs;

Statement stmt;

public BookDatabase() {

try {

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");

//

加载

JDBC-ODBC

桥驱动程序

String url = "jdbcdbc:Book";

con = DriverManager.getConnection(url);

//

连接数据库

HDB //stmt

提供一个创建

SQL

查询、执行查询、得到返回结果

的空间

stmt = con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,

ResultSet.CONCUR_READ_ONLY);

} catch (Exception ex) {

System.out.println(ex);

}

}

/*

增加一行用户名、密码数据

*/

public boolean insertData(String id, String name, String where, String

price, String date) {

try {

int rtn = stmt.executeUpdate("INSERT INTO Book VALUES('" + id

+ "','"

+ name + "','" + where + "','" + price + "','" + date

+ "')");

if (rtn != 0) {

return true;

} else {

return false;

}

} catch (Exception et) {

System.out.println(et);

return false;

}

}

/*

* public boolean deleteData(String id){ try{ int rtn =

* stmt.executeUpdate("DELETE FROM Book WHERE id=001" ); if( rtn != 0 ){

* return true; } else{ return false; } } catch(Exception e){

* System.out.println( e ) return false; } } public boolean Select(String

* id){ try{ int rtn = stmt.executeUpdate("SELECT * FROM BookIn WHERE

* id='"+id+"'");

*

* if( rtn != 0 ){ return true; } else{ return false; } } catch(Exception

* e){ System.out.println( e ) return false; } }

*/

}

//

出库数据库代码:

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.ResultSet;

import java.sql.Statement;

哪能下载java网上商城源码,并且可执行的

据我了解shop++是java类型的商城,有提供源代码,不过是一款需付费才能商用的软件。

求简单实现网上商城功能的java代码

平时在线10k人大概是让你创建一个数据库连接池,大小设置10k。

下面是一个图书商城的数据库表部分,供你参考

set utf8

DROP TABLE IF EXISTS d_product;

CREATE TABLE d_product (//用来存放总商品,入图书种类

id int(12) NOT NULL auto_increment,

product_name varchar(100) NOT NULL,

description varchar(100) default NULL,

add_time bigint(20) default NULL,

fixed_price double NOT NULL,

dang_price double NOT NULL,

keywords varchar(200) default NULL,

has_deleted int(1) NOT NULL default '0',

product_pic varchar(200) default NULL,

PRIMARY KEY (id)

) ENGINE=InnoDB DEFAULT CHARSET=utf8;

INSERT INTO d_product VALUES (23,'上课睡觉的故事','上课睡觉的故事',1237873000234,200,180,'key',0,'15.jpg');

DROP TABLE IF EXISTS d_book;

CREATE TABLE d_book (//用来存放图书的具体内容

id int(12) NOT NULL,

author varchar(200) NOT NULL,

publishing varchar(200) NOT NULL,

publish_time bigint(20) NOT NULL,

word_number varchar(15) default NULL,

which_edtion varchar(15) default NULL,

total_page varchar(15) default NULL,

print_time int(20) default NULL,

print_number varchar(15) default NULL,

isbn varchar(25) default NULL,

author_summary text NOT NULL,

catalogue text NOT NULL,

PRIMARY KEY (id)

) ENGINE=InnoDB DEFAULT CHARSET=utf8;

INSERT INTO d_book VALUES (24,'阿斗,'地球出版社',1237873000234,'1万','1','100',1,NULL,'12345678','无描述,'好书!');

DROP TABLE IF EXISTS d_category;

CREATE TABLE d_category (//商城图书目录

id int(12) NOT NULL auto_increment,

turn int(10) NOT NULL,

en_name varchar(200) NOT NULL,

name varchar(200) NOT NULL,

description varchar(200),

parent_id int(10),

PRIMARY KEY (id)

) ENGINE=InnoDB DEFAULT CHARSET=utf8;

INSERT INTO d_category VALUES (1,1,'Book','图书',NULL,0);

DROP TABLE IF EXISTS d_category_product;

CREATE TABLE d_category_product (//这个是连接目录和书籍具体信息的表

id int(12) NOT NULL auto_increment,

product_id int(10) NOT NULL,

cat_id int(10) NOT NULL,

PRIMARY KEY (id)

) ENGINE=InnoDB DEFAULT CHARSET=utf8;

INSERT INTO d_category_product VALUES (72,24,1);

DROP TABLE IF EXISTS d_item;

CREATE TABLE d_item (//这个订单条目表

id int(12) NOT NULL auto_increment,

order_id int(10) NOT NULL,

product_id int(10) NOT NULL,

product_name varchar(100) NOT NULL,

dang_price double NOT NULL,

product_num int(10) NOT NULL,

amount double NOT NULL,

PRIMARY KEY (id)

)

DROP TABLE IF EXISTS d_order;

CREATE TABLE d_order (//订单表

id int(10) NOT NULL auto_increment,

user_id int(10) NOT NULL,

status int(10) NOT NULL,

order_time bigint(20) NOT NULL,

order_desc varchar(100) default NULL,

total_price double NOT NULL,

receive_name varchar(100) default NULL,

full_address varchar(200) default NULL,

postal_code varchar(8) default NULL,

mobile varchar(20) default NULL,

phone varchar(20) default NULL,

PRIMARY KEY (id)

) ENGINE=InnoDB;

DROP TABLE IF EXISTS d_receive_address;

CREATE TABLE d_receive_address (//收件人信息表

id int(12) NOT NULL auto_increment,

user_id int(11) NOT NULL,

receive_name varchar(20) NOT NULL,

full_address varchar(200) NOT NULL,

postal_code varchar(8) NOT NULL,

mobile varchar(15) default NULL,

phone varchar(20) default NULL,

PRIMARY KEY (id)

) ENGINE=InnoDB;

insert into d_receive_address values(1, 6,'Java','sun.cn','10000800','12345','67890');

insert into d_receive_address values(2, 6,'JavaJavaJava','ibm.cn','10000600','12345','67890');

DROP TABLE IF EXISTS d_user;

CREATE TABLE d_user (//用户表,用户信息

id int(12) NOT NULL auto_increment,

email varchar(50) NOT NULL,

nickname varchar(50) default NULL,

password varchar(50) NOT NULL,

user_integral int(12) NOT NULL default '0',

is_email_verify char(3),

email_verify_code varchar(50) default NULL,

last_login_time bigint default NULL,

last_login_ip varchar(15) default NULL,

PRIMARY KEY (id),

UNIQUE KEY email (email)

) ENGINE=InnoDB DEFAULT CHARSET=utf8;

发表评论

评论列表

  • 泪灼槿畔(2022-06-14 11:22:26)回复取消回复

    archar(15) default NULL, print_time int(20) default NULL, print_number varchar(15) default NULL, isbn varchar(25)

  • 余安断渊(2022-06-14 00:48:07)回复取消回复

    return false; } } } //进库数据库代码:import java.sql.Connection; import java.sql.DriverManager; import java.s

  • 辞眸诤友(2022-06-14 03:38:45)回复取消回复

    E IF EXISTS d_order;CREATE TABLE d_order (//订单表 id int(10) NOT NULL auto_increment, user_id int(10) NOT NULL, status int(10) NOT